
Kim Jong Un admits lack of 'basic living necessities' is 'serious political issue' in North Korea

North Korean supreme leader Kim Jong Un acknowledged a "failure to provide" rural communities with "basic living conditions" in a speech on Thursday.

"Today, failure to satisfactorily provide the people in local areas with basic living necessities including condiments, foodstuff and consumption goods has arisen as a serious political issue that our Party and government can never sidestep," the dictator said to the assembly, according to Korean Central News Agency.
